Design & Methodology A fingerprint database with a total of 80 images and 10 different classes was used. Originality The features of the images were extracted with the feature extraction method originally developed. Findings The 300x300 images were divided into 25x25 sub-images and the feature vector was obtained. Conclusion The developed segmentation and feature extraction algorithm can be applied to any image of equal size.
